Output ece1890afbf0b913070c90e2189fdb9d0d83cca8a1cd13c4b88f164686c8b42a:2

value
25040786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c758b461e853b0f7bc2f7ca275458d9018e5daa7 OP_EQUAL
address
3Ks4f2HZiZNTvBjmmGfbzDLm5saKZvD24k
transaction
ece1890afbf0b913070c90e2189fdb9d0d83cca8a1cd13c4b88f164686c8b42a
confirmations
369947
spent
true